Dr Ming Chow

Paediatrician

MBBS (Melb) FRACP DRANZCOG

Ming is a consultant paediatrician who has worked for a number of years in private paediatric practice, seeing children and teenagers with neurodevelopmental and behavioural disorders.  He has been working with children and adolescents who have had difficulties with their attention, learning, early development, behaviour, socialisation and mood, helping with the diagnosis and management of their difficulties.

​Ming trained as a general paediatrician and has an extensive experience, working in a variety of settings including Metropolitan, Rural and Regional centres, in both hospital and practice practice settings.  Ming connects well with children and parents.  He believes in a holistic approach to management, working collaboratively with parents, teachers, therapists, psychologists and other specialists to help identify and address the varied needs of the patient.

Ming will work with families, to help them understand the needs and issues their children may be experiencing, and provide them guidance of how they could best help their children. He believes in advocating for services and educational provisions which would help support the child as well as their families. He is passionate about seeing children and adolescents thrive in their personal, social  and academic lives, in trying to help them meet their potential.
